Unicode 6.0 (2010) brought us this phase. Astrology and lunar-cycle followers love this glyph for the refinement stage \u2014 finishing what was started, getting close to fruition.<\/p>\n<p>Astronomy enthusiasts use it more literally. The shape sits between the dramatic full moon and the more subtle quarter, making it a great visual middle ground. Pair it with sparkles, stars, or growth-themed emojis for spiritual posts.<\/p>\n<p>Photographers love this phase because the moon looks bright and dramatic without losing its rounded shape. Some users employ it for almost-there messaging \u2014 projects nearly done, plans coming together.
